About The Secret: Dare to Dream
When a powerful storm wrecks a family's home, Miranda Wells, a widowed mother of three, struggles to keep her life afloat. A weathered handyman named Bray Johnson arrives to repair the damage, offering more than a simple fix. As the roof is patched and the walls mended, Bray shares a hopeful philosophy rooted in the idea that the universe can deliver what you truly want if you believe and stay receptive. The conversations mix practical hardship with uplifting principles, and the Wells family begins to see small miracles brighten their days. The bond between Miranda and Bray grows in the midst of risk and loss, guiding them toward a future they hadn't imagined. Their lives begin to regain hope again.
Directed by Andy Tennant, The Secret: Dare to Dream draws on The Secret by Rhonda Byrne with a screenplay by Bekah Brunstetter and Rick Parks. The 2020 drama features Katie Holmes as Miranda Wells and Josh Lucas as Bray Johnson.
The film earned about $3,215,636 worldwide, a modest performance given its 21 million budget, reflecting limited reach despite star power. Some markets discussed its hopeful appeal amid competing releases and streaming options. Its audience reactions varied by region and platform.
The film taps into The Secret philosophy, stressing intention and gratitude. While not a blockbuster, it contributes to conversations about how mindset can support families under pressure and spark acts of kindness. The message resonates with viewers seeking hopeful stories during difficult times and special moments of generosity for all.
Critics generally treated it as a light faith-leaning drama that leans into optimism over realism. The film centers on Miranda's family, their financial strain, and the idea that belief paired with practical care can open doors, recover hope, and redefine what counts as success for some viewers and readers alike.
